Deleting process templates that are no longer valid
Use the deleteInvalidProcessTemplate.py
administrative script to delete, from the Business Process Choreographer
database, BPEL process templates that are no longer valid.
Before you begin
You must know both the name of the template and the ValidFromUTC value for the template that you want to delete. If you do not have that information, perform Listing information about process and task templates first.
The following conditions must be met:- Run the script in the connected mode, that is,
do not use the wsadmin
-conntype none
option. - You must have either operator or deployer authority.
- At least one cluster member must be running.
- If you are not working with the default
profile, use the wsadmin
-profileName profile
option to specify the profile.
About this task
The deleteInvalidProcessTemplate.py
script
removes from the database those templates, and all objects that
belong to them, that are not contained in any corresponding valid
application in the WebSphere® configuration
repository. This situation can occur if deploying an application
was canceled or the application not stored in the configuration repository
by the user. These templates usually have no impact. They are not
shown in Business Process Choreographer Explorer.
There are rare situations in which these templates cannot be filtered. They must then be removed from the database with the following scripts.
You cannot use this script to remove templates of valid applications from the database. This condition is checked and a ConfigurationError exception is thrown if the corresponding application is valid.